CVE-2026-93872

high

Description

Cotonti 1.0.0 passes the base64-decoded cb parameter to unserialize() without allowed_classes restriction in the comments plugin EditAction. Registered users with comment write permissions can instantiate arbitrary PHP objects and potentially achieve file write or code execution through gadget chains.
